Ole Romer
Ole Rømer was a 17th-century Danish astronomer whose observations of Jupiter’s moons provided crucial evidence for the concept of a finite speed of light. He meticulously tracked eclipses of Io, noting variations in their timing based on Earth's position in its orbit. Ejnar Hertzsprung
Ejnar Hertzsprung was a twentieth-century Danish astronomer whose work fundamentally shaped our understanding of stars. He established a critical relationship between a star’s color and its luminosity, leading to the development of the Hertzsprung-Russell diagram.
